The compact Fisher 2052 spring-and-diaphragm rotary actuator is designed to reduce valve/actuator envelope dimensions to provide greater valve installation versatility for both skids and tight processing lines where space is at a premium.
The 2052 actuator can be installed on rotary-shaft valve bodies for
throttling or on-off applications. The actuator linkage features a
clamped shaft lever and a single pivot point to reduce lost motion
between the actuator and the valve. The result is 0.5% or less typical
variability for a Fisher rotary control valve assembly. Other 2052
features include an inherent failsafe position on loss of operating
air. In contrast to piston style actuators that rely on O-ring seals,
the double-sided diaphragm in the 2052 provides a longer service life,
says the vendor. The actuator is available in three sizes,
